The Rieder family lived at 58 Roy Street in Berlin, but moved to Montreal in 1912 because of Talmon's business interests there; they lived in Berlin again from 1915 to 1917 and then Martha and the children moved back to the Roy Street home in Kitchener ... »

Scope and content

Photograph of the grounds of the Ontario Ladies' College with Trafalgar Castle surrounded by trees partially visible in background. In the distance, at left, are two students, one of whom is holding a tennis racket.
